Commercial roof repair services involve assessing and fixing issues that compromise the integrity of a building’s roofing system. Skilled contractors inspect roofs to identify problems such as leaks, damaged flashing, cracked or missing shingles, and areas of wear caused by weather exposure or aging materials. Once issues are diagnosed, they perform necessary repairs to restore the roof’s protective barrier,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the building’s safety and functionality. These services are essential for ensuring that commercial properties remain secure and protected from the elements.

Many problems can be addressed through professional roof repair, including persistent leaks, ponding water, damaged or deteriorated roofing materials, and structural issues caused by storm damage or heavy winds. Repair work can also involve replacing damaged sections, resealing seams, and reinforcing vulnerable areas to extend the life of the roof. Addressing these issues promptly can help avoid costly replacements and reduce the risk of interior damage, mold growth, and compromised insulation. Local contractors are equipped to handle a wide range of repairs tailored to the specific needs of each property.

Commercial roof repair services are typically used on various types of properties, including office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These structures often have flat or low-slope roofs that are more susceptible to pooling water and debris buildup. Property owners and managers turn to local service providers when they notice signs of roof damage or leaks, especially after severe weather events or as part of routine maintenance. Reliable repairs can help preserve the value of the property and ensure that tenants or employees are protected from potential roof-related issues.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or roof repairs, such as patching leaks or replacing small sections,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Medium-Size Projects - Larger repairs like replacing a significant section or addressing extensive damage usually range from $600 to $2,500. These projects are common for commercial properties needing substantial fixes but not full replacements.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of replacements generally cost between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. While most projects are in the lower to mid-range, larger, more complex replacements can exceed $20,000.

Complex or Large-Scale Jobs - Extensive repairs or multi-story commercial roof overhauls can reach $20,000 or more. These higher-tier projects are less frequent and depend on factors like roof size, design complexity, and material choices.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ial roof repairs do local contractors handle? Local contractors typically handle a range of repairs including leak fixes, membrane patching, flashing repairs, and damage from weather or debris.

How can I tell if my commercial roof needs repair? Signs such as water stains, visible damage, pooling water, or increased energy costs can indicate the need for professional roof assessment and repair.

Are there different repair options for flat and sloped commercial roofs? Yes, repair methods vary depending on the roof type, with flat roofs often requiring membrane repairs and sloped roofs needing shingle or metal fixes.

What should I consider when choosing a local roofing service provider? It's important to consider their experience with commercial roofs, reputation, and ability to provide comprehensive repair solutions.

Can local contractors perform emergency repairs on commercial roofs? Many service providers offer emergency repair services to address urgent issues like leaks or storm damage to protect property.
